INTERVIEW with Monique Jeremiah || Founder of Diversity Models

From ex-teacher to founder of Australia’s top modelling agency for disabilities and diversity, Monique Jeremiah is the highly outspoken, trailblazing and daring entrepreneur and media figure behind Diversity Models. As leader of the most innovative and ground-breaking agency for disabilities, multicultural, mature age and curve models, Monique broke all the rules in the modelling industry. Unapologetically she leads the country’s very first NDIS registered provider modelling agency and proudly creates the pathway for unique and diverse models to enter the industry.

SD: What are some challenges you have faced in your life?



MJ: The greatest challenges I faced was in my 20s and early 30s when I tried to enter the modelling industry repeatedly but I was constantly rejected because I was just so different and diverse and I didn't fit the mould. This challenge required me to develop an incredible level of resilience, passion and determination in order to fight for my place and career and dream as a full-time model. Most people who wish to be models, especially in the fashion industry, never make it their full-time career, simply work for free or simply end up being hobby models because the industry is tough, it's competitive and you really need to stand out. You also need to be prepared to have a clear time schedule, no other job and be ready to dedicate yourself if you are truly going to make as modelling is very flexible, but it requires real flexibility in your time and ability to work with projects. I'm lucky I had the fight in me to break through all the resistance and unpredictability and I turned modelling into a full-time paying career and now step by step, I am developing the same for my models. 


SD: And what are some highlights?



MJ: My highlight was when I went from full-time model at 35, to founder of Diversity Models. That was a huge milestone which required me to really move from artist to entrepreneur and to think more strategically in order to grow the business so rapidly. 
It's now been 2.5 years and Diversity Models is thriving, operates nationally and we have a wonderful team of models and creatives on the journey.
